Professional oncology social workers provide free emotional and practical support for people with cancer, caregivers, loved ones and the bereaved.

The National Alliance for Caregiving’s mission is to contribute to research, advocacy and innovation to make life better for caregivers. Several guidebooks are available on their website: www.caregiving.org https://www.cancersupportcommunity.org/ Through the Cancer Support Community, MyLifeLine csc.mylifeline.org provides professional programs of emotional support, education and hope for people impacted by cancer at no charge so that no one faces cancer alone.

Also available: Cancer Support Helpline (888-793-9355)
